Rinse in partnership with London streetwear brand Boxfresh, will be hosting a stage for the first time, at the legendary Notting Hill Carnival on the Rough But Sweet soundsystem. Being a streetwear brand whose history is synonymous with dance culture, Boxfresh are especially proud to partner with Rinse for this seminal anniversary. The headliner's for the event have today been announced as Katy B And Chase & Status, other acts joining the line-up include: Tinashe, Route 94, Skream Bicep, Becky Hill & Artwork.

This event will be live on Rinse and is the launch to a programme of birthday celebrations that run until December, culminating in Rinse – Late at Tate Britain. Double celebrations at carnival as Boxfresh themselves are this year celebrating their 25th anniversary.
